Select
Discover openings Why join our team Growth opportunities Work perks Locations
St. Petersburg, Russia / Saratov, Russia
or
We are actively seeking a great Lead Big Data Engineer who is interested in joining our growing projects for one of the biggest IT companies. Come be a part of our bright engineering team. We offer open communication, empowerment, innovation, and a customer-centric culture.

You will be involved in the process of development of the Big Data ecosystem for gathering and analyzing data on customer behavior and getting business meaningful insights out of it.
Software stack:
- SQL, Scala, Python
- Spark, Airflow, Hadoop (Hive)
- Github
- AWS, Google Cloud: Storage, DataProc, DataFlow, PubSub, BigQuery, BigTable


Software stack:
  • SQL, Scala, Python
  • Spark, Hadoop
  • Github
  • Google Cloud (GCP): Storage, DataProc, DataFlow, PubSub. Big Query, Big Table
Responsibilities:
  • Leading the Team of Big Data Developers
  • Participate in the design and development of high-performance business applications, from requirements analysis to production
  • Constantly improve software quality (evaluate and incorporate new libraries, tools, and technologies; code reviews; refactoring; testing; etc.)
  • Analyze and improve application performance
  • Search for simple and robust solutions to complex tasks
  • Work in an Agile methodology environment where innovation, teamwork, and creativity are the keys to success
  • Collaborate with a team of developers, QA engineers, analysts
Requirements:
  • Commercial Big Data experience
  • Good self and team management skills and ability to deliver functionality e2e
  • Strong communication and problem-solving skills
  • 3+ years in Python Software Development
  • Strong SQL (BigQuery)
  • GCP + Airflow (python) 
  • Understanding of building ETL processes on Hadoop and Spark
  • 1+ years in Scala Software Development will be a plus 
  • Education in Computer Science or similar theoretical knowledge in CS: algorithms and complexity estimation, data structures, operating systems, programming languages
  • Understanding of distributed architectures and scalability principles
  • Knowledge of Linux/Unix-based operating systems (bash/ssh/ps/grep etc.)
  • Understanding of SDLC and Agile methodologies in particular
  • Experience with unit and integration testing
  • Desire and ability to quickly learn new tools and technologies
  • Ability to proactively identify and solve engineering problems
  • Good interpersonal communication skills, both verbal and written
  • Fluent English
  • Ability to travel to the USA for business trips

We offer:

  • Opportunity to work on bleeding-edge projects
  • Work with a highly motivated and dedicated team
  • Competitive salary
  • Flexible schedule
  • Medical insurance
  • Benefits program
  • Social package - medical insurance, sports
  • Corporate social events
  • Professional development opportunities

About us:

Grid Dynamics is the engineering services company known for transformative, mission-critical cloud solutions for retail, finance and technology sectors. We architected some of the busiest e-commerce services on the Internet and have never had an outage during the peak season. Founded in 2006 and headquartered in San Ramon, California with offices throughout the US and Eastern Europe, we focus on big data analytics, scalable omnichannel services, DevOps, and cloud enablement.

or

Your personal recruiter

Don’t see the right opportunity?

Contact us anyway and let’s talk! To apply, send your resume and cover letter to jobs@griddynamics.com

Grid Dynamics is an equal opportunity employer. We are committed to creating an inclusive environment for all employees during their employment and for all candidates during the application process. All qualified applicants will receive consideration for employment without regard to, and will not be discriminated against based on, age, race, gender, color, religion, national origin, sexual orientation, gender identity, veteran status, disability or any other protected category. All employment is decided on the basis of qualifications, merit, and business need.

Grid Dynamics Privacy Policy and E-verify